(8/4) Purpose-Driven Younger Workforce Pushes Employers to Advocate for Change

By Joanne Kaldy / August 4, 2022

According to a survey from Deloitte, Gen Zers and Millennials most want work/life balance, learning and development, and sustained workplace changes from their employers.

Additionally, these generations:

  • Are worried about the cost of living, climate change, wealth inequity, geopolitical conflicts, and the ongoing pandemic.
  • Are determined to drive change.
  • Struggle with financial anxiety, lack of work/life balance, and consistently high stress levels.
  • Are demanding sustained change, including higher compensation, more meaningful and flexible work, more action to address climate change, and an increased focus on wellbeing.

Deloitte’s Michele Parmelee says, “There is an urgent need, and an opportunity, for business leaders to redefine the talent experience to better meet people’s needs.”
